×
Register Here to Apply for Jobs or Post Jobs. X

Junior Software Developer

Job in Grand Rapids, Kent County, Michigan, 49528, USA
Listing for: iMPact Business Group, Inc.
Full Time position
Listed on 2026-06-03
Job specializations:
  • Software Development
    Backend Developer, Software Engineer
Salary/Wage Range or Industry Benchmark: 80000 - 100000 USD Yearly USD 80000.00 100000.00 YEAR
Job Description & How to Apply Below

Position Overview

Junior Software Developer:
We are seeking a motivated junior software developer to join our development team. This role is ideal for someone early in their career who is eager to grow technical skills while contributing to the design, development, and maintenance of scalable web-based applications in an Agile/Scrum environment alongside experienced developers.

Responsibilities include developing and supporting RESTful and/or Graph

QL APIs, contributing to API documentation using tools such as Swagger/OpenAPI, troubleshooting, debugging, and optimizing application performance and reliability, building backend services that integrate with databases and external systems, and participating in code reviews to follow best practices for clean, maintainable code. You will also support testing efforts (unit and integration testing), learn and understand system architecture and workflows, document processes, and contribute ideas for system improvements and scalability.

Collaboration with cross-functional team members in an Agile development environment is essential.

Responsibilities
  • Develop and support RESTful and/or Graph

    QL APIs
  • Contribute to API documentation using tools such as Swagger/OpenAPI
  • Troubleshoot, debug, and optimize application performance and reliability
  • Build backend services that integrate with databases and external systems
  • Participate in code reviews and follow best practices for clean, maintainable code
  • Support testing efforts, including unit and integration testing
  • Learn and understand system architecture, workflows, and application functionality
  • Document processes and contribute ideas for system improvements and scalability
  • Collaborate with cross-functional team members in an Agile development environment
Qualifications & Skills
  • Bachelor s degree in Computer Science, Software Engineering, or a related field (or in progress)
  • Understanding of software development fundamentals and requirements gathering
  • Exposure to full stack development technologies, including: HTML5, JavaScript, Type Script, CSS (TDD)
  • Ability to perform unit and integration testing
  • Experience or interest in using AI tools to support development and productivity
  • Strong problem-solving skills and willingness to learn in a fast-paced environment
#J-18808-Ljbffr
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ary